Village of Jeffersonville
Jeffersonville is a village in Sullivan County, New York, United States. The population was 369 at the 2020 census. The name is derived indirectly from Thomas Jefferson.Places of Interest

Stone Arch Bridge

Stone Arch Bridge is a historic stone arch bridge located at Kenoza Lake, near Jeffersonville, in Sullivan County, New York. It was built in 1873 and is a solid masonry structure with an arched roadway supported by three arches made of hand cut stone. Stone Arch Bridge is situated 2½ miles southwest of Village of Jeffersonville.

Youngsville

Youngsville is a hamlet in Sullivan County, New York, United States. The community is located in the Town of Callicoon along New York State Route 52, 7.2 miles west of Liberty. Youngsville has a post office with ZIP code 12791, which opened on March 10, 1851. Youngsville is situated 2½ miles northeast of Village of Jeffersonville.
Kenoza Lake

Kenoza Lake is a hamlet in the town of Cochecton, Sullivan County, New York, United States. The community is located along New York State Route 52, 14.5 miles west-northwest of Monticello. Kenoza Lake is situated 3½ miles south of Village of Jeffersonville.
